Transaction 6232bbf320d2ae7ea179884520cf6ba526643197f92b97f715bf77ef7b674066
1 Input
1 Output
-
6232bbf320d2ae7ea179884520cf6ba526643197f92b97f715bf77ef7b674066:0
- value
- 14980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 188877bf80a4dc125f4a2d410d2dc33830f2de36 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13EihYvzAKYBLpfpnfhq9Ta9K2f655g7g6